Return-Path: Delivered-To: apmail-ws-axis-c-dev-archive@www.apache.org Received: (qmail 94595 invoked from network); 18 May 2006 04:34:36 -0000 Received: from hermes.apache.org (HELO mail.apache.org) (209.237.227.199) by minotaur.apache.org with SMTP; 18 May 2006 04:34:36 -0000 Received: (qmail 6242 invoked by uid 500); 18 May 2006 04:34:36 -0000 Delivered-To: apmail-ws-axis-c-dev-archive@ws.apache.org Received: (qmail 6227 invoked by uid 500); 18 May 2006 04:34:36 -0000 Mailing-List: contact axis-c-dev-help@ws.apache.org; run by ezmlm Precedence: bulk list-help: list-unsubscribe: List-Post: List-Id: "Apache AXIS C Developers List" Reply-To: "Apache AXIS C Developers List" Delivered-To: mailing list axis-c-dev@ws.apache.org Received: (qmail 6216 invoked by uid 99); 18 May 2006 04:34:35 -0000 Received: from asf.osuosl.org (HELO asf.osuosl.org) (140.211.166.49) by apache.org (qpsmtpd/0.29) with ESMTP; Wed, 17 May 2006 21:34:35 -0700 X-ASF-Spam-Status: No, hits=0.3 required=10.0 tests=MAILTO_TO_SPAM_ADDR,SPF_PASS X-Spam-Check-By: apache.org Received-SPF: pass (asf.osuosl.org: domain of damitha23@gmail.com designates 64.233.184.232 as permitted sender) Received: from [64.233.184.232] (HELO wr-out-0506.google.com) (64.233.184.232) by apache.org (qpsmtpd/0.29) with ESMTP; Wed, 17 May 2006 21:34:34 -0700 Received: by wr-out-0506.google.com with SMTP id 68so365520wri for ; Wed, 17 May 2006 21:34:14 -0700 (PDT) DomainKey-Signature: a=rsa-sha1; q=dns; c=nofws; s=beta; d=gmail.com; h=received:message-id:date:from:user-agent:x-accept-language:mime-version:to:subject:references:in-reply-to:content-type:content-transfer-encoding; b=ac9ezS+H7GLYm5sSFceluMdYJoLKbSSQbScU8MHCJv28iugnoZZCgHREqWs1c2g2D2dSWfVXSWxgRHCYgOkc82Te4+shRq5Z2dwnnSp/jeT2upTXW7qwkjSkqR+0z3NpaaYwN3Evc9dIk040MEH3nnTBjtTI0OLrcrF3SZ1UxZg= Received: by 10.54.78.20 with SMTP id a20mr102879wrb; Wed, 17 May 2006 21:34:14 -0700 (PDT) Received: from ?192.168.1.180? ( [222.165.179.32]) by mx.gmail.com with ESMTP id 33sm108662wra.2006.05.17.21.34.11; Wed, 17 May 2006 21:34:13 -0700 (PDT) Message-ID: <446BF93F.6040501@gmail.com> Date: Thu, 18 May 2006 10:34:07 +0600 From: Damitha Kumarage User-Agent: Mozilla Thunderbird 1.0.7 (X11/20051013) X-Accept-Language: en-us, en MIME-Version: 1.0 To: Apache AXIS C Developers List Subject: Re: [Axis2][Fwd: Modified Axis2C folder structure] References: <446AF87C.5090907@gmail.com> <446AFA0A.3030604@gmail.com> <446B0BAD.3040307@gmail.com> <5e8118f30605170520h7cb186d6uac383f35a013d106@mail.gmail.com> <446B3156.8090901@gmail.com> <446B6252.1070801@wso2.com> In-Reply-To: <446B6252.1070801@wso2.com>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Virus-Checked: Checked by ClamAV on apache.org X-Spam-Rating: minotaur.apache.org 1.6.2 0/1000/N Sahan Gamage wrote: >Hi all, > >If I get it correctly, according to the new structure, we won't have the >"modules" directory any more. I personally don't like the idea of not >having the "modules" directory. > Dont' worry. It's my mistake of not depicting the modules folder in the diagram. > Also where is the "addressing" module ? > > The diagram did not include the folders that won't affect by the new folder structure. So adressing should be there as before >Also I don't understand the reason for the wsdl module brought to top >level ? Is wsdl module going to be a separate project ? I thought it is >a part of axis2 core. > > It is like axiom should be placed in c/modules/wsdl. It does not belong to axis2 c engine core. >I would rather go for something like this. > >c/ >|- modules/ >| |- core/ >| | |- wsdl/ (if I am not mistaken) >| | |- other core modules >| |- addressing/ >| |- security/ (or rampart) - in the future >|- util/ >|- axiom/ >|- xml-schema/ >|- woden/ >|- guththila/ > > See my previous inlined comments thanks damitha >- Sahan > > >Samisa Abeysinghe wrote: > > > >>nandika jayawardana wrote: >> >> >> >>>Hi, >>>In addition to the above folder structure we will have to move out >>>guththila as a seperate project ( at the moment guththila is also in >>>xml folder). >>> >>> >>+ 1. >> >>Samisa... >> >> >> >>> >>>thanks >>>nandika >>> >>> >>>On 5/17/06, *Damitha Kumarage* >>> wrote: >>> >>> Samisa Abeysinghe wrote: >>> >>> > Samisa Abeysinghe wrote: >>> > >>> >> Correct prefix... >>> >> >>> >> -------- Original Message -------- >>> >> Subject: Modified Axis2C folder structure >>> >> Date: Wed, 17 May 2006 16:40:27 +0600 >>> >> From: Damitha Kumarage >> > >>> >> Reply-To: Apache AXIS C Developers List >>> > >>> >> To: axis-c-dev@ws.apache.org >>> >>> >> >>> >> >>> >> >>> >> Hi, >>> >> Since we are going to separate Axis2 C sub/dependant projects >>>into >>> >> separate projects >>> >> and at the same time keep them under Axis2 C folder struture >>> for some >>> >> time, I would like to propose the >>> >> following folder structure. >>> >> >>> >> >>> >> >>> >> C >>> >> | >>> >> >>> >> >>> >>>--------------------------------------------------------------------------------------------------- >>> >>> >> >>> >> | | | >>> >> | | | >>> >> util axiom xml-schema woden >>>wsdl >>> >> core >>> >> >>> >> Note that axiom contains all parser, soa and om related stuff. >>>util >>> >> contain all >>> >> platform stuff as well. >>> > >>> > >>> > +1. >>> > >>> >> >>> >> In make install the sub/dependant project includes go into into >>> >> c/inclue as following >>> >> >>> >> C >>> >> | >>> >> include >>> >> | >>> >> >>>_________________________________________________________________ >>> >> | | >>> >> | | >>> >> util om >>> >> woden xml_schema >>> >> >>> >> Other headers all go into c/include as before >>> > >>> > >>> > Please rename om to axiom >>> > Also does this mean that we have to prefix the header inclusion >>> with >>> > folder name? If yes then that is lots of trouble. >>> >>> OK, Then for the time being I'll have axiom and util headers >>> installed >>> into c/include. Other wise we will have to >>> change all header files to include prefixed with project name >>> >>> > Also, I propose to keep the same prefix even if we now have >>> different >>> > folder names. e.g. even tough om and soap headers are in axiom >>> folder, >>> > the prefix would remain as axis2_om and axis2_soap. >>> > >>> > P.S. is there anyway we can shorten xml_schema? >>> >>> I prefer to keep it xml_schema because this going to be a C >>>version of >>> Xml Schema project. We did no architecture >>> changes to Xml Schema so keeping the name as it is a good thing >>> >>> Thanks >>> Damitha >>> >>> > >>> > Thanka, >>> > Samisa... >>> > >>> >> >>> >> All libs goes into c/lib. >>> >> >>> >> Thanks >>> >> Damitha >>> >> >>> >> >>> >> >>> > >>> > >>> >>> >>> >>> >> >> > > > >